🔧 Daily Cleaning and Basic Care for Your Devices

Dust is the quiet enemy of every computer. In a home office, dust gathers on vents, ports and screens within days, and it directly affects cooling and visibility. Start with a soft, lint-free microfiber cloth for all exterior surfaces. For the WTR PRO AMD, wipe the top and side panels where dust settles and check the front intake vents every week. A few minutes of wiping at the start of each week prevents grime from hardening into layers that require far more effort to remove later.

For the SH6 and ST9-J touchscreens, use a slightly damp cloth with distilled water or a screen-safe cleaner. Avoid alcohol-based sprays, which can damage the oleophobic coating over time. Keep food and drinks away from the devices, and if you handle the tablets near windows or on carpets, wipe them down at the end of each day. The same discipline applies to the rugged mini PC solutions that anchor your home setup: a quick daily wipe prevents buildup that leads to overheating.

Cooling and Thermal Management

The WTR PRO AMD runs demanding workloads, and heat is its main stress factor. Keep the mini PC on a hard, flat surface with at least ten centimeters of clearance on every side. Never block the exhaust fans with papers, folders or cables. If you notice the fan spinning loudly or the chassis feeling hot, clean the internal fans and heat sinks with compressed air at least every three months.

In warmer months, position the device away from direct sunlight and windows. An ambient temperature below 30 degrees Celsius keeps the AMD processor in its comfort zone and reduces the risk of thermal throttling during video conferences and heavy multitasking sessions.

💾 System Updates and Storage Health

Software maintenance is just as important as hardware care. Enable automatic Windows updates on the WTR PRO AMD, SH6 and ST9-J so security patches and driver fixes install without manual reminders. Check for firmware updates from the manufacturer quarterly, and reboot all three devices at least once a week to clear cached processes and keep the operating systems stable. Set aside a few quiet minutes each week for these reboots so they never interrupt a live session.

The 6.5-inch Windows SH6 Rugged Industrial Tablet is a favorite for mobile tasks around the home office, while the 8-inch Windows ST9-J Rugged Industrial Tablet offers a larger canvas for documents, diagrams and presentations. Both rely on internal SSDs, so keep at least twenty percent of storage free and monitor drive health through the built-in storage tools. Back up work files to a separate drive or cloud service every week so a hardware fault never becomes a data loss event.

🔧 Battery Care and Charging Best Practices

Batteries are the first components to age on portable devices. For the SH6 and ST9-J, avoid letting the battery drop below twenty percent before recharging, and avoid keeping it at one hundred percent for extended periods. A charge range between thirty and eighty percent is ideal for long-term battery health. Use only the original charger and cable that came with the tablet, or a certified replacement, because incompatible power adapters can damage the battery and the charging circuitry. Heat accelerates battery aging faster than almost anything else, so charge in a ventilated spot and keep the tablets out of hot cars and direct sunlight.

If a tablet will sit unused for more than a week, store it at around fifty percent charge in a cool, dry place. This simple habit dramatically slows capacity loss and keeps the devices ready when remote work demands spike.
